Top-seeded Olpe girls, Northern Heights girls lose at State
By Michael Ashford
Thursday, March 6, 2008
The No. 1-seeded Olpe Lady Eagles lost in the first round of the Class 1A State Tournament in Hays on Thursday, falling to Wheatland-Grinnell, 58-55, in overtime.
The loss ends Olpe's season with a 25-1 record.
In Class 3A at Hutchinson, the Northern Heights Ladycats ended their season with a 50-34 loss to Cimarron.
Heights ends its season with a 15-9 record.
